As mentioned in https://doi.org/10.1016/j.jspi.2013.03.018 (https://pages.stat.wisc.edu/~wahba/stat860public/pdf4/Energy/JSPI5102.pdf), the energy distance can be used to implement a linkage method for hierarchical clustering.
We should study the best way to implement it, if possible in a manner compatible with existing hierarchical clustering methods, such as scipy methods and scikit-learn AgglomerativeClustering class.
